If you are looking for a comforting, nutritious, and utterly delicious meal to brighten up any day, this Lentil and Vegetable Soup Recipe is an absolute must-try. Packed with hearty lentils, vibrant vegetables, and infused with warm, earthy spices, this soup brings together simplicity and flavor in a way that feels like a warm hug in a bowl. Whether you want a quick weeknight meal or a dish that lets you savor every spoonful, this recipe is your new best friend in the kitchen.

Ingredients You’ll Need
The beauty of this soup lies in its straightforward ingredients, each chosen to build layers of flavor, texture, and color. Every element, from the fragrant spices to the fresh vegetables, works together to create a soup that’s as nourishing as it is delicious.
- 1 tablespoon olive oil: Helps to gently sauté vegetables and adds a smooth richness.
- 1 medium onion, chopped: Provides a sweet and savory base flavor.
- 2 carrots, diced: Adds natural sweetness and a vibrant orange color.
- 2 celery stalks, diced: Contributes a subtle crunch and earthy undertone.
- 3 cloves garlic, minced: Infuses the soup with a deep, aromatic warmth.
- 1 cup dried lentils, rinsed: The heart of this recipe, lending protein and a satisfying texture.
- 1 (14.5 oz) can diced tomatoes: Brings a tangy brightness and enhances the soup’s body.
- 1 bay leaf: Adds a delicate herbal note that deepens the soup’s flavor.
- 1 teaspoon ground cumin: Introduces a smoky, nutty character.
- 1/2 teaspoon ground turmeric: Gives a warm, golden hue and slight earthiness.
- 1/2 teaspoon smoked paprika: Provides a subtle smokiness to boost depth.
- 1/2 teaspoon dried thyme: A fragrant herb that rounds out the spice blend.
- 6 cups vegetable broth (or water): The flavorful liquid base that ties all ingredients together.
- 1 medium zucchini, diced: Adds a tender, fresh bite and balances the heartiness.
- 1 cup spinach or kale, chopped: Brings vibrant green color and a boost of vitamins.
- Salt and pepper, to taste: Essential seasonings to enhance and brighten all flavors.
- Fresh lemon juice (optional, for serving): A splash to lift and refresh each spoonful.
How to Make Lentil and Vegetable Soup Recipe
Step 1: Sauté the Vegetables
Start by heating the olive oil in a large pot over medium heat. Toss in the chopped onion, carrots, and celery. Cook them gently for about 5 to 7 minutes, stirring occasionally, until they soften and the aromas start to fill your kitchen. This step is where your soup begins to build a beautifully fragrant foundation.
Step 2: Add the Garlic and Spices
Next, stir in the minced garlic along with the ground cumin, turmeric, smoked paprika, and dried thyme. Cook everything together for about 1 minute to toast the spices and let their incredible fragrance awaken your senses. This little burst of flavor makes a huge difference to the overall depth of your soup.
Step 3: Add Lentils and Liquids
Now it’s time to layer in the heartiness. Add the rinsed lentils, diced tomatoes, vegetable broth, and the bay leaf. Bring the mixture to a boil, then reduce the heat to low and let the soup simmer uncovered for 25 to 30 minutes. This slow simmer allows the lentils to become perfectly tender and the flavors to meld into a rich, comforting broth.
Step 4: Add Zucchini and Greens
Once the lentils are cooked through, stir in the diced zucchini and chopped spinach or kale. Continue cooking for another 5 to 7 minutes until the zucchini turns tender and the greens have wilted just right. This step adds bright freshness and keeps the soup lively and vibrant.
Step 5: Season the Soup
Remove the bay leaf, then season your soup with salt and pepper to your liking. For an extra zing, consider squeezing a bit of fresh lemon juice in at this point. This little touch brightens the flavors beautifully and gives your soup just the right balance.
Step 6: Serve
Ladle the soup into bowls and serve it piping hot. If you want to add a little something extra, garnish with fresh parsley or a light drizzle of olive oil. This finishes your Lentil and Vegetable Soup Recipe with both flair and flavor, making it as inviting on the eyes as it is on the palate.
How to Serve Lentil and Vegetable Soup Recipe

Garnishes
Fresh herbs like parsley or cilantro add a burst of color and a layer of herbal brightness that pairs wonderfully with the warm spices. A drizzle of good-quality olive oil or even a sprinkle of parmesan can also elevate your bowl visually and flavor-wise.
Side Dishes
This soup is wonderful on its own but pairs beautifully with crusty bread for dipping or a light side salad to add a crisp texture contrast. Garlic bread or warm pita also complements the earthy, hearty flavors of the soup.
Creative Ways to Present
For a fun twist, serve the soup in small bread bowls for an impressive and cozy presentation. You could also add a dollop of Greek yogurt or swirl in a bit of pesto for an extra creamy or herbaceous touch. These options turn a simple bowl of soup into a memorable dining experience.
Make Ahead and Storage
Storing Leftovers
Leftover Lentil and Vegetable Soup keeps beautifully in the fridge for up to 4 days. Store it in an airtight container to preserve the fresh flavors and prevent any aroma transfer with other foods. The flavors often deepen even more after a day.
Freezing
This soup freezes exceptionally well, making it a perfect make-ahead meal. Cool it completely, pour into freezer-safe containers or bags, leaving some headspace, and freeze for up to 3 months. Just be mindful that the texture of the greens may soften slightly after freezing.
Reheating
When you’re ready to enjoy, simply thaw in the fridge overnight if frozen, then warm the soup gently on the stovetop over medium-low heat, stirring occasionally. If it has thickened too much, add a splash of water or broth to loosen it up, and taste again for seasoning before serving.
FAQs
Can I use red lentils instead of brown lentils in this Lentil and Vegetable Soup Recipe?
Absolutely! Red lentils cook faster and tend to break down more, giving the soup a creamier texture. Just keep an eye on cooking times as they may need less simmering than brown lentils.
Is it possible to make this soup gluten-free?
Yes, this Lentil and Vegetable Soup Recipe is naturally gluten-free, especially if you use gluten-free vegetable broth. It’s a fantastic option for those with gluten sensitivities.
Can I add protein like chicken or sausage to the soup?
Of course! Adding cooked chicken or sausage can turn this soup into a heartier meal. Just cook the meat separately or before adding the vegetables to ensure everything is perfectly cooked.
How can I make this soup spicier?
If you like some heat, add a pinch of cayenne pepper or some chopped fresh chili along with the spices. This little kick pairs beautifully with the earthiness of the lentils and spices.
What’s the best way to store leftovers if I don’t want the greens to get too soggy?
To keep the greens fresh, consider storing them separately and stir them into the soup just before reheating and serving. This way, they maintain their bright color and texture.
Final Thoughts
There is something truly special about this Lentil and Vegetable Soup Recipe that makes it a timeless comfort food. Its vibrant colors, rich flavors, and nourishing ingredients make every spoonful a joy. I encourage you to try making it soon—it’s easy, rewarding, and perfect for sharing with those you care about.
Print
Lentil and Vegetable Soup Recipe
- Prep Time: 10 minutes
- Cook Time: 35 minutes
- Total Time: 45 minutes
- Yield: 6 servings
- Category: Soup
- Method: Stovetop
- Cuisine: Mediterranean
- Diet: Vegetarian
Description
A hearty and nutritious Lentil and Vegetable Soup packed with wholesome vegetables, fragrant spices, and tender lentils simmered to perfection. This comforting soup is easy to prepare and perfect for a healthy, satisfying meal any time of the year.
Ingredients
Vegetables
- 1 medium onion, chopped
- 2 carrots, diced
- 2 celery stalks, diced
- 1 medium zucchini, diced
- 1 cup spinach or kale, chopped
- 3 cloves garlic, minced
Legumes and Canned Goods
- 1 cup dried lentils, rinsed
- 1 (14.5 oz) can diced tomatoes
Liquids
- 6 cups vegetable broth (or water)
- 1 tablespoon olive oil
Spices and Seasonings
- 1 bay leaf
- 1 teaspoon ground cumin
- 1/2 teaspoon ground turmeric
- 1/2 teaspoon smoked paprika
- 1/2 teaspoon dried thyme
- Salt and pepper, to taste
- Fresh lemon juice (optional, for serving)
Instructions
- Sauté the vegetables: Heat olive oil in a large pot over medium heat. Add the chopped onion, carrots, and celery. Cook for about 5–7 minutes, stirring occasionally, until the vegetables are softened.
- Add the garlic and spices: Add the minced garlic, ground cumin, turmeric, smoked paprika, and dried thyme. Stir for about 1 minute, allowing the spices to become fragrant and release their flavors.
- Add the lentils and liquids: Stir in the rinsed lentils, diced tomatoes, vegetable broth (or water), and the bay leaf. Bring the soup to a boil, then reduce the heat to low and let it simmer, uncovered, for about 25–30 minutes, or until the lentils are tender and cooked through.
- Add the zucchini and greens: Once the lentils are cooked, add the diced zucchini and chopped spinach or kale. Continue to cook for another 5–7 minutes, until the zucchini is tender and the greens have wilted nicely into the soup.
- Season the soup: Remove the bay leaf and season the soup with salt and pepper to taste. If desired, add a squeeze of fresh lemon juice to brighten the flavors and add a slight tang.
- Serve: Ladle the soup into bowls and serve hot. Optionally garnish with fresh parsley or a drizzle of olive oil for extra depth and presentation.
Notes
- Feel free to substitute kale with spinach or other leafy greens.
- You can use water instead of vegetable broth but broth enhances flavor.
- Add fresh herbs like parsley or cilantro for extra freshness at serving.
- This soup keeps well in the fridge for up to 4 days and freezes nicely for up to 3 months.
- Adjust spices to your taste preference for more or less heat and smokiness.

